Assertion : Chiasmata is formed during diplotene. 
Reason  : Chiasmata are formed due to deposition of nucleoproteins.
 (a) If both Assertion and Reason are true and the Reason is the correct explanation of the Assertion.
 (b) If both Assertion and Reason are true but the Reason is not the correct explanation of the Assertion.
(c) If Assertion is true but Reason is false. 
(d) If both Assertion and Reason are false. 

Answer: (c) If Assertion is true but Reason is false. 


The beginning of diplotene is recognised by the dissolution of the

synaptonemal complex and the tendency of the recombined

homologous chromosomes of the bivalents to separate from each other

except at the sites of crossovers. These X-shaped structures, are called

chiasmata. In oocytes of some vertebrates, diplotene can last for

months or years.

The final stage of meiotic prophase I is diakinesis. This is marked by

terminalisation of chiasmata. During this phase the chromosomes are

fully condensed and the meiotic spindle is assembled to prepare the

homologous chromosomes for separation. By the end of diakinesis, the

nucleolus disappears and the nuclear envelope also breaks down.

Diakinesis represents transition to metaphase.
